11 new Patients Under Investigation

KUCHING: Eleven new Patients Under Investigation (PUI) cases for the novel coronavirus (2019-nCoV) were recorded in Sarawak as of 10.30am yesterday.  Sibu Hospital has the highest number at nine followed by one case each at Sarawak General Hospital in Kuching and Miri Hospital. No rental for Kuching Waterfront event space

KUCHING: The Kuching North City Commission (DBKU) stressed that it has never imposed any rental charge for event space at Kuching Waterfront.
